Q: Is 1,266,769 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,266,769 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,266,769 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1266769 can be evenly divided by 1 7 37 67 73 259 469 511 2,479 2,701 4,891 17,353 18,907 34,237 180,967 and 1,266,769, with no remainder.

Since 1,266,769 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,266,769, it is not a prime number.
